Down With tHE CAPS LOCK KEy
Jul 7, 2009, 07 :34 UTC (3 Talkback[s]) (3736 reads)

(Other stories by Gene Weingarten)

"The QWERTY keyboard, laid out during the early days of the typewriter, when it was necessary to keep frequently used letters at a distance from each other so the keys didn't "stick," but which now is primarily a facilitator of common typos like "teh," "aobut" and "mabye."

"Software that automatically corrects common typos, forcing you to type and retype "teh," "aobut" and "mabye" until the computer is satisfied this was your intent.

"Software that doesn't let you stop numbering items in a list, even after the list is finished."
